Just yesterday, me and my friend were talking about chill mode. It’s the one that you feel at peace. And I noted that high performance people know how to get into it really fast. He asked me if I have any recommendation how to get into it.

I stopped, thought for a moment and said: “I don’t want to recommend you anything. And that’s probably my recommendation.” I know, strange, but it made sense to me.

When I was on a journey to discover the calming method or the one to feel good, call it whatever you want. I went to YouTube. I ended up trying gazillion things. From changing diets to sleep, and whatever you can imagine. I ended up with mixed results. The more I worked on it, the more I found out that the ones, that worked the best, were the ones I made for myself by myself.

So, is my recommendation strange? Possibly. But, is the best one I can give.

That’s not to say: “Don’t discover.” Go wherever you want, experiment, do whatever you want. But at the end of the day, come back and ask yourself: “Did it worked?” Be honest, it’s all you need. That’s sounds so cheesy. But whatever, I like it! It’s cool cool.

Wanna be high performing chill guy? Maybe don’t go to stuff that makes you unchill in a first place.

One helpful pointer is: “Be bored.”
